Description

The substitution of old, fossil-fired heating boilers with new, innovative fuel-driven heat pumps as e.g. gas-fired absorption heat pumps is showing an enormous CO2-reduction potential especially when it comes to retrofitting. IEA HPP Annex 43 is aiming at overcoming market barriers in order to enable a broad market penetration of these environmentally friendly systems. The state-of-technology and research will be collected, the CO2-reduction potentials of heating various building types will be investigated via simulation and a field monitoring of a heat pump system will be conducted. In addition, a market report including the market barriers for gas-fired AHPs in Austria will be carried out and a list of market supporting measures will be compiled. The results will be communicated at international expert meetings and will be distributed to the Austrian stakeholders.
